Step into a warm, welcoming atmosphere where the shop's colorful, beautiful design invites you to indulge. Known for freshly made gluten-free donuts crafted to order, this cozy spot offers impeccable service and a delightful experience for gluten-free treat lovers.

Good to know

1

They keep the gluten-free donuts completely separate.

2

Parking is available, but limited seating inside.

3

Expect fresh gluten-free donuts made to order any day.

3231 S Mill Ave Ste. 101, Tempe, AZ 85282, USA

Went here for the gluten free donuts! They were fluffy cake type dipped in whichever frosting you ask for and they can add sprinkles.
J
I love Sesame Donuts! I've been here a few times now and it has always been a great experience. Whether it is a bustling Sunday morning or a laidback weekday afternoon, I always get the same high-quality food and service. They have great deals/prices, and hands down one of the best lattes in Tempe (not to mention under $4!). I am also Celiac and have enjoyed the gluten free donuts here several times with no issues. My friends have reported all of their other donuts and bagels are amazing as well!
